With Brevo, you can organize subscribers into lists (e.g. “Newsletter subscribers”, “Customers”), which can then be further broken down into segments (e.g. “Engaged subscribers”, “Inactive subscribers”). These segments can be based on contact field criteria and behavior (email opens, clicks, etc.). brevo segments Brevo offers a few pre-made templates to get you started, but you can also build segments from scratch, combining multiple conditions. You can also automate the process – for example, when a new subscriber signs up, they can be added to the right list or segment based on predefined conditions.
However, one drawback we found is that Brevo doesn’t have a dedicated tagging feature. You can work around this by using contact attributes, but it lacks the flexibility that tagging provides for more advanced list management. ActiveCampaign, on the other hand, takes list management to the next level with its powerful Segment Builder. It allows you to create highly detailed segments using a wide variety of conditions, such as tags, actions (like clicks or email opens), and even event data (e.g. whether a contact visited a specific webpage). You can apply up to conditions per segment, giving you granular control over how you target your audience.
